At Each Fuel Fill

It is important to perform these underhood checks at
each fuel fill.

Engine Oil Level Check

Notice: It is important to check the engine oil
regularly and keep it at the proper level. Failure to
keep the engine oil at the proper level can cause
damage to the engine not covered by the vehicle
warranty.
Check the engine oil level and add the proper oil if
necessary. See Engine Oil on page 5-17.
Engine Coolant Level Check
Check the engine coolant level and add DEX-COOL
coolant mixture if necessary. See Engine Coolant
on page 5-28.
Windshield Washer Fluid Level Check
Check the windshield washer fluid level in the windshield
washer fluid reservoir and add the proper fluid if
necessary.

At Least Once a Month

Tire Inspection and Inflation Check
Inspect the vehicle's tires for wear and make sure
they are inflated to the correct pressures.
See Inflation - Tire Pressure on page 5-66.
